强关联锰氧化物Nd_(0.5)Ca_(0.5)Mn_(0.85)Al_(0.15)O_3低温下磁性质的研究 被引量:2

Magnetic Properties of Strong Associations Manganese Oxide Nd_(0.5)Ca_(0.5)Mn_(0.85)Al_(0.15)O_3
下载PDF
导出
摘要 选用高温固相反应法制备多晶样品Nd0.5Ca0.5Mn0.85Al0.15O3.通过XRD表明样品为单相正交的钙钛矿结构,空间群Pnma.通过物理性质测量系统对样品M-T,M-H性质进行测量,表明低温下样品呈相分离态,磁有序的冻结温度为32 K,铁磁团簇的自旋阻塞温度为4 K.2 K温度下有磁滞现象. Polyerystalline sample Nd0.5 Ca0.5 Mn0.85 Al0.15 O3 was synthesized by high temperatrue solid - state reaction. XRD results show that the sample is single -phase orthorhombic structure, Pmna space group. The M- T,M- H were tested through physical property measurement system. Samples show that low temperature separation condition. The freezing temperature of magnetic order is 32 K. Spin ferromagnetic clusters of blocking the temperature is 4 K. There is hysteresis phenomenon under 2 K temoerature.
